Greetings from Hayward

View down Main Street with businesses on both sides, including drug stores, grocery stores, appliance stores and an insurance/real estate office. Automobiles are parked at an angle along the curbs on both sides. Caption reads: "Greetings from Hayward, Wisconsin." Text on back reads: "Muskie Capital of the World. Noted for its Beautiful Lakes, Excellent fishing and resort accommodations. Photo by Bob Young." |
